9 They must hold fast to the mystery of the faith with a clear conscience. 10 Let them first be tested. They can be appointed as deacons only if they are beyond reproach.

11 Women[a] must likewise exhibit a sense of dignity and not be given to spreading slander. They must be temperate and faithful in all things.

- 1 Timothy 3:11 Women: this word could refer either to women deacons or to women who were the wives of deacons. Scholars usually opt for the first reference since there is no possessive (e.g., “their”) and since they are introduced by the same word as in v. 8 (“similarly . . . likewise”), indicating that women too could possess the ministry of deacon. See note on Rom 16:1, in which verse Paul sends greetings to “our sister Phoebe, who is a deaconess of the Church at Cenchreae.”

9 They must keep hold of the deep truths of the faith with a clear conscience.(A) 10 They must first be tested;(B) and then if there is nothing against them, let them serve as deacons.
11 In the same way, the women[a] are to be worthy of respect, not malicious talkers(C) but temperate(D) and trustworthy in everything.
